Po\u010fme si vysvetli\u0165, pre\u010do bat\u00e9rie LFP dominuj\u00fa v tomto priestore - od technickej sily a\u017e po dlhodob\u00fa hodnotu.<\/p><div class=\"wp-block-image\"><figure class=\"aligncenter size-full\"><img fetchpriority=\"high\" decoding=\"async\" width=\"600\" height=\"600\" src=\"https:\/\/www.kmdpower.com\/wp-content\/uploads\/kamada-powerwall-battery-10kwh-kmd-pl48200.png\" alt=\"\" class=\"wp-image-2703\"\/><\/figure><\/div><p class=\"has-text-align-center\"><a href=\"https:\/\/www.kmdpower.com\/sk\/10kwh-battery-for-powerwall-home-battery-storage-product\/\" target=\"_blank\" rel=\"noreferrer noopener\">10kWh Power wall Home Battery<\/a><\/p><h2 class=\"wp-block-heading\" id=\"what-are-lfp-batteries-\">\u010co s\u00fa bat\u00e9rie LFP?<\/h2><h3 class=\"wp-block-heading\" id=\"basic-chemistry-and-composition\">Z\u00e1klady ch\u00e9mie a zlo\u017eenia<\/h3><p>V bat\u00e9ri\u00e1ch LFP sa ako kat\u00f3da pou\u017e\u00edva fosfore\u010dnan l\u00edtia a \u017eeleza (LiFePO4) a ako an\u00f3da grafit. Na rozdiel od chemick\u00fdch technol\u00f3gi\u00ed NMC (nikel-mang\u00e1n-kobalt) alebo NCA (nikel-kobalt-hlin\u00edk) sa LFP nespolieha na kobalt alebo nikel. T\u00e1to stabiln\u00e1 ch\u00e9mia zvy\u0161uje bezpe\u010dnos\u0165 a trvanlivos\u0165 - dve vlastnosti, ktor\u00e9 si pri stacion\u00e1rnom skladovan\u00ed energie jednoducho nem\u00f4\u017eete dovoli\u0165 prehliadnu\u0165.<\/p><h3 class=\"wp-block-heading\" id=\"key-technical-specs-relevant-to-storage\">K\u013e\u00fa\u010dov\u00e9 technick\u00e9 \u0161pecifik\u00e1cie t\u00fdkaj\u00face sa ukladania<\/h3><ul class=\"wp-block-list\"><li><strong>Nomin\u00e1lne nap\u00e4tie<\/strong>: ~ 3,2 V na ka\u017ed\u00fd \u010dl\u00e1nok<\/li>\n\n<li><strong>Hustota energie<\/strong>: ~90-140 Wh\/kg pre LFP; ni\u017e\u0161ie ako NMC (~150-220 Wh\/kg)<\/li>\n\n<li><strong>\u017divotnos\u0165 cyklu<\/strong>: \u010casto dosahuj\u00fa viac ako 4 000 cyklov pri h\u013abke vybitia 80% (DoD)<\/li><\/ul><p>Stru\u010dne povedan\u00e9, LFP obetuje trochu energetickej hustoty, ale vynahrad\u00ed to ve\u013ekou spo\u013eahlivos\u0165ou.<\/p><h2 class=\"wp-block-heading\" id=\"why-lfp-batteries-excel-in-long-term-storage-applications\">Pre\u010do bat\u00e9rie LFP vynikaj\u00fa v aplik\u00e1ci\u00e1ch dlhodob\u00e9ho skladovania<\/h2><h3 class=\"wp-block-heading\" id=\"1-exceptional-cycle-life-and-calendar-life\">1. V\u00fdnimo\u010dn\u00e1 \u017eivotnos\u0165 cyklu a \u017eivotnos\u0165 kalend\u00e1ra<\/h3><p>Bat\u00e9rie LFP \u010dasto poskytuj\u00fa&nbsp;<strong>4 000 a\u017e 7 000 cyklov<\/strong>, v z\u00e1vislosti od toho, ako hlboko ich vypust\u00edte a ako dobre ich udr\u017eiavate. Pri re\u00e1lnom pou\u017eit\u00ed m\u00f4\u017eete o\u010dak\u00e1va\u0165 10 a\u017e 15 rokov spo\u013eahliv\u00e9ho v\u00fdkonu.<\/p><p>Vezmite si napr\u00edklad mikrosie\u0165ov\u00e9 projekty z Kalifornie. Tamoj\u0161ie banky LFP si aj po desiatich rokoch v prev\u00e1dzke st\u00e1le zachov\u00e1vaj\u00fa kapacitu viac ako 80%. Bal\u00edky NMC pri podobnom pou\u017eit\u00ed zvykn\u00fa zanika\u0165 r\u00fdchlej\u0161ie, zvy\u010dajne vydr\u017eia len 2 000 - 3 000 cyklov.<\/p><p>V ned\u00e1vnom projekte off-grid v mexickom \u0161t\u00e1te Baja z\u00e1sobovac\u00ed syst\u00e9m LFP s kapacitou 100 kWh nap\u00e1jal od\u013eahl\u00e9 po\u013enohospod\u00e1rske stanovi\u0161te viac ako 11 rokov s degrad\u00e1ciou kapacity len 8% - pozoruhodn\u00e9 pre tropick\u00e9 podnebie.<\/p><h3 class=\"wp-block-heading\" id=\"2-superior-thermal-and-chemical-stability\">2. Vynikaj\u00faca tepeln\u00e1 a chemick\u00e1 stabilita<\/h3><p>Tepeln\u00fd \u00fanik? Toho sa pri LFP ve\u013emi ob\u00e1va\u0165 nebudete. Tieto bat\u00e9rie s\u00fa odoln\u00e9 vo\u010di vznieteniu alebo expl\u00f3zii, a to aj pri n\u00e1ro\u010dnom zaobch\u00e1dzan\u00ed alebo pre\u0165a\u017een\u00ed. To je obrovsk\u00fd rozdiel, ak in\u0161talujete v dom\u00e1cnostiach, tov\u00e1r\u0148ach alebo vzdialen\u00fdch chat\u00e1ch.<\/p><p>V\u00e4\u010d\u0161ina zost\u00e1v LFP nepotrebuje ani zlo\u017eit\u00e9 kvapalinov\u00e9 chladenie. Z\u00e1kladn\u00fd syst\u00e9m s n\u00faten\u00fdm pr\u00edvodom vzduchu zvy\u010dajne sta\u010d\u00ed na zjednodu\u0161enie in\u0161tal\u00e1cie a zn\u00ed\u017eenie n\u00e1kladov na \u00fadr\u017ebu.<\/p><h3 class=\"wp-block-heading\" id=\"3-excellent-shelf-life\">3. Vynikaj\u00faca trvanlivos\u0165<\/h3><p>Dlhodob\u00e9 skladovanie neznamen\u00e1 len \u010dast\u00e9 pou\u017e\u00edvanie. Niekedy potrebujete syst\u00e9m, ktor\u00fd je t\u00fd\u017edne alebo mesiace ne\u010dinn\u00fd, ale v pr\u00edpade potreby st\u00e1le bezchybne funguje. LFP&nbsp;<strong>n\u00edzka miera samovyb\u00edjania<\/strong>&nbsp;(menej ako 3% mesa\u010dne) je na to ide\u00e1lny. Od\u00eddete od neho a vr\u00e1tite sa s vedom\u00edm, \u017ee je st\u00e1le pripraven\u00fd.<\/p><p>V skuto\u010dnosti telekomunika\u010dn\u00e9 stanice na kanadskom vidieku pou\u017e\u00edvali bat\u00e9rie LFP na z\u00e1lo\u017en\u00e9 nap\u00e1janie a aj po mesiacoch odpojenia po\u010das zimn\u00fdch odst\u00e1vok sa jednotky okam\u017eite vr\u00e1tili do prev\u00e1dzky s neporu\u0161en\u00fdm n\u00e1bojom 95%.<\/p><h3 class=\"wp-block-heading\" id=\"4-cost-effectiveness-over-time\">4. Efekt\u00edvnos\u0165 n\u00e1kladov v \u010dase<\/h3><p>Na prv\u00fd poh\u013ead sa m\u00f4\u017ee zda\u0165, \u017ee LFP je drah\u00fd.
